article thumbnail

The Legal Ethics of Cloud Computing & SaaS

Percipient

For instance, the Alabama Disciplinary Commission , drawing guidance from Arizona and Nevada , concluded in Opinion 2010-02 that lawyer cloud computing and the use third parties to store client data is permissible “provided the attorney exercises reasonable care in doing so.”

article thumbnail

Don’t Be Late and Ineffective with Litigation Holds

Joshua Gilliland

The Court found that the duty to preserve was the date of an earlier lawsuit involving quota-related allegations that was “strikingly similar” to the instant case, which was January 31, 2008, opposed to the date of the current lawsuit, filed on May 25, 2010.
